SpaceX makes history with SES-10 launch
Today SpaceX once again made history with the first launch of a previously flown first stage booster. The Falcon 9 lifted off at 6:27 pm EDT today with the SES-10 payload. SpaceX CRS-10 launches
This morning SpaceX made history once again as it made its first launch from Launch Complex 39A at Kennedy Space Center. When will Falcon 9 Return to Flight

Now comes SpaceX’s true test
This morning SpaceX suffered the first failure of their Falcon 9 rocket as it explode two minutes into the CRS-7 mission. Initial data from Elon Musk indicates that an over-pressure event happened on the second stage. There was an overpressure event in the upper stage liquid oxygen tank.
